Position Overview/Responsibilities for the Project Financial Specialist:

- Lead a new integration project from QuickBase to Microsoft Dynamics SL
- Manage system integration projects across multiple business entities or platforms
- Troubleshoot and support end users with QuickBase-related issues
- Compile and analyze operational and financial data across multi-platform environments
- This is a 6-month contract-to-hire position
- A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ience is required

Required Skills for Project Financial Specialist:

- 3-5 years of experience as a Project Specialist or Project Manager implementing QuickBase as a tool
- Expertise with QuickBase and in-depth understanding of system functionality and its alignment with business processes
- Familiarity with inventory operations, including transfers, assignments, and cycle counts
- Strong problem-solving and communication skills to support technical and business users
- Construction or Telecom industry experience is preferred
